Web28 mag 2024 · 1 Open Settings, and click/tap on the Personalization icon. You can also right click or press and hold on the taskbar, and click/tap on Taskbar settings. 2 Click/tap on Taskbar on the left side, and turn On or Off (default) Automatically hide the taskbar in desktop mode on the right side. (see screenshot below) 3 You can now close Settings if ...
